**Description**
The Adult Education Department in Karlstad conducts activities in Swedish for Immigrants (SFI), Komvux as adapted education, theoretical courses at basic and upper secondary levels, as well as vocational, apprenticeship, and combined education, including Higher Vocational Education.
In adult education, we work to develop our students' knowledge and skills to strengthen their position in the labor market and society, as well as to promote their personal development.

**About Karlstad Municipality**
The Upper Secondary and Adult Education Administration is responsible for the education of approximately 7,000 students in upper secondary school, adapted upper secondary school, adult education at basic and upper secondary levels, higher vocational education, and Swedish for immigrants. Our schools stand for knowledge, experience, safety, quality, and joy! Our approximately 650 employees create education for all.
